Match the definitions of function to the court type.
-Appellate courts.


A) Their function is to hear cases at 'first instance', including considering submissions from the parties to the action and relevant evidence including witness submissions, if relevant and admissible.
B) Their function is to reconsider the application of legal principles to the case (which may be by way of case stated) or, in some instances, it may include a reconsideration of the facts.
